Default White oblong pills

This is the 1st time that I have used this site. Hopefully someone can help me. I have found a few pills in a teenager’s room that I am unsure what they are. The pills are oblong and scored on one side with a 0 and 7 on either side of the score. On the other side there is the letter A. I work for a drug distributor and still am having problems identifying this. Can someone please HELP?

I believe this may be a new pill by Aurobindo Pharma called:

CITALOPRAM HBR 40MG
